Hi. Ann McGill born about 1841 in Ireland, was the daughter of Capt John McGill and Jane McCauley. Has anyone any connections with, or ideas about, this family please? Capt John McGill was deceased when daughter Ann married Robert Gordon in Springburn, Lanark in 1860. My grandmother was a daughter from this marriage. Can anyone at all shed any light on this one? It looks as though I am banging my head on a brick wall. Any pointers at all will be most appreciated. traa dy liooar Derek
